City - Inglewood

Less than five miles east of LAX and about 11 miles southwest of Downtown Los Angeles, Inglewood boasts a prime location near the Pacific Coast with convenience to several beaches and parks. Inglewood is surrounded by four major freeways: Interstates 405, 105, 110, and 10, which all afford residents simple travels and commutes.

Aside from its convenient location, Inglewood has plenty to offer residents and visitors alike. The Forum, designed by the same architect as Madison Square Garden in New York, hosts a variety of major concerts and events on a regular basis. The Los Angeles Stadium at Hollywood Park is under construction in Inglewood and set to house the Los Angeles Rams and the Los Angeles Chargers. Local restaurants abound in Inglewood, which tend to flourish due to strong community support of local businesses.

Inglewood also offers a wide variety of apartments available for rent, from newly constructed luxury apartments to more modest apartments in historic structures.
